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Fernhill to Norwood Junction start from as little as £27.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Fernhill to Norwood Junction start from £102.50 one way, or £87.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Fernhill to Norwood Junction are available for £82.40 one way, or £299.00 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

One of the main aspects of Fernhill station is its simplicity. The station operates without a ticket office or ticket machines, meaning you'll need to purchase your tickets online or through mobile apps before arrival. This station supports smartcard validation but does not issue them. Assistance is readily available through helplines and accessible contact points, although there are no customer help points within the station.

While there are no waiting rooms or lounges to pass the time, a dedicated seating area ensures comfort while you await your train. There’s no Wi-Fi or refreshment facilities on-site, and although there’s step-free access throughout the station, you'll find no accessible toilets or nearby parking facilities.

Travel Connections at Your Fingertips

If you're considering ongoing journeys, Fernhill makes it manageable with its transport links, albeit limited. The rail replacement bus stop can be found close by on Aberdare Road, facilitating transitions during railway disruptions. Unfortunately, there are no direct cycling facilities or hire options, so cycle aficionados should plan accordingly.

Facilities and Services

Norwood Junction is equipped with essential amenities designed to accommodate a wide range of passenger needs. If you're planning to buy or collect train tickets, you’ll find a conveniently located ticket office, open every day from early morning until late evening. For those preferring automated methods, ticket machines are available 24/7, with accessibility features designed for ease of use. It's worth noting that smartcards cannot be issued or validated at this station.

For passenger assistance, staff are available throughout most of the day, every day of the week. While the station lacks a dedicated waiting room, there are seating areas for travelers to use as they await their trains. Although there are refreshments available — including a coffee shop on Platform 1 and a kiosk on Platforms 4/5 — shoppers might find the retail offering rather limited.

In terms of accessibility, step-free access is available though somewhat limited — with platform connections facilitated via a subway with steps. For accessible travel, nearby stations like Anerley, West Norwood, or East Croydon may be more suitable options.

Connecting Your Journey

Norwood Junction also offers various onward travel options. For local bus services, you can utilize bus stops on Selhurst Road to connect to destinations such as East Croydon and Sutton or head towards Balham and London Bridge. If you prefer a more personalized journey, taxis can be arranged through services like Addison Lee or Gett.
